Business Description
Since 1992, Skills Strategies International has been a trusted name in vocational education and training (VET) in Perth, Western Australia. As a Registered Training Organisation (RTO 2401), SSI delivers nationally recognised qualifications, skill sets, and micro-credentials across a wide range of industries — helping individuals, businesses, schools, and government organisations build real, job-ready skills. With over 85 courses on scope, flexible study modes (classroom, online, virtual, and RPL), and a consultative approach to corporate training, SSI tailors every solution to its clients' goals.
